<p>Do you ever wonder if Jesus understands you? Identifies with you? Well, in this episode of A Closer Look Pastor Cullen and Clayton walk through Mark 1:1-15 and show that many of the things that Jesus did are for connection with us. He did them so that he could set an example but also to connect and identify with us in those moments of trial. His baptism and his temptation are both narratives of connection with us.
